#  library(askgpt)
#  login()
#  #> ℹ It looks like you have not provided an API key yet. Let me guide you through the process:
#  #>   1. Go to <https://platform.openai.com/account/api-keys>
#  #>   2. (Log into your account if you haven't done so yet)
#  #>   3. On the site, click the button + Create new secret key
#  #>   to create an API key
#  #>   4. Copy this key into R/RStudio

#  library(askgpt)
#  log_init()
#  
#  # Ask any question you like and get an answer in your Console
#  askgpt("What is an R function?")
#  askgpt("Can you help me with the function aes() from ggplot2?")
#  
#  # this is a special trigger prompt that sends your last command to GPT
#  mean[1]
#  askgpt("What is wrong with my last command?")
#  
#  askgpt("Can you elaborate on that?")
